This company needs to be looked into. Firstly I went through a training process that was a month and 2 weeks long 5 days a week 8/9 hours a day and the first 2 weeks are free and followed by R500 a week as the stipend. The campaign BGL insurance work load is a lot, back to back calls, many things to look out for when on the call, 1 hour break and 9 hours answering calls. The required productivity from agents compared to the remuneration, is appalling. That company is exploiting South Africans because it is aware of the employment rate. The contract states that if you resign they have the right to with hold your remuneration. I resigned beginning of June and Mays public holiday and night shift allowance was not paid to me. As stated this company needs to be looked into for real.
